My initial testing took place at an outdoor shooting range, with distances ranging from 25 to 100 yards. The weather was clear and mild, ideal for zeroing and initial accuracy testing. I paired the barrel with a reliable bolt carrier group, a quality adjustable gas block, and a red dot sight.
The Ballistic Advantage barrel performed admirably right out of the gate. Recoil was manageable, and the muzzle blast, while significant with an 8″ barrel, wasn’t excessive. I quickly achieved a consistent zero at 50 yards, and groups were surprisingly tight for such a short barrel, hovering around 2-2.5 MOA with standard 55-grain FMJ ammunition.
I experienced no malfunctions during the first 200 rounds. My adjustable gas block helped fine-tune the gas system for smooth cycling and reliable lockback, even with weaker ammunition. The only surprise was just how loud an 8″ barrel can be, even with hearing protection; investing in a quality suppressor is now a must.

Specifications
Caliber: 5.56x45mm NATO. This is the standard chambering for AR-15 rifles, ensuring compatibility with a wide range of ammunition.
Barrel Length: 8 inches. This short length makes it ideal for compact builds, offering excellent maneuverability in tight spaces.
Material: 4150 Chrome Moly Vanadium Steel. This is a durable steel alloy commonly used in firearms barrels, known for its ability to withstand high temperatures and pressures.
Finish: Black QPQ (Quench Polish Quench). This nitriding process hardens the steel and provides excellent corrosion resistance, ensuring a long service life.
Profile: DPR (Defense Profile). The DPR profile is a lightweight profile designed to balance weight savings with adequate rigidity for accuracy.
Feed Ramp Extension: QPQ Coated M4 Feed Ramp Extension. M4 feed ramps are designed to improve feeding reliability, especially with a wide range of ammunition.
Twist Rate: Not specified in provided data, but typical twist rate for 5.56 NATO is 1:7 or 1:8. This twist rate effectively stabilizes a wide range of bullet weights.
These specifications are critical for a short-barreled rifle because they directly influence reliability, accuracy, and overall longevity. The 4150 CMV steel and QPQ finish provide a robust foundation, while the M4 feed ramps ensure smooth feeding. The 8″ length necessitates careful attention to gas system tuning for optimal cycling.
